As of Wednesday afternoon:

Sharp money on:

East Carolina +17.5 to +16.5 at Tulsa – 30% tickets and 68% of the money.

Temple +4.5 at Tulane – 30% tickets and 63% of the money.

Cincinnati -6 to -6.5 – 66% tickets and 93% of the money.

Southern Miss -1 hosting Rice – 43% tickets and 71% of the money.

Troy +4.5 to +3 at Arkansas State – 69% tickets and 91% of the money.

Rutgers +13 to +11 hosting Indiana – 41% of the tickets and 91% of the money.

Iowa -2 hosting Northwestern – 43% tickets and 70% of the money.

Ohio State -11.5 at Penn State – 70% tickets and 94% of the money.

UNC -6.5 at Virginia – 62% tickets and 98% of the money.

San Jose State -9.5 at New Mexico – 35% tickets and 94% of the money.

Sharp Totals:

Memphis vs Cincinnati under 60.5 to 55.5 – 38% tickets and 61% of the money.  Was larger

Iowa State vs Kansas under 55 to 52 – 48% tickets and 81% of the money.

Boston College vs Clemson over 59.5 to 61.5 – 37% tickets and 95% of the money.

Michigan State vs Michigan over 53.5 – 39% tickets and 76% of the money.

Georgia vs Kentucky under 44.5 to 43.5 – 55% tickets and 94% of the money.

UAB vs LA Tech under 49 to 47 – Dual Action 78% tickets and 99% of the money.

TCU vs Baylor under 50.5 to 48.5 – 36% tickets and 95% of the money.

Virginia Tech vs Louisville over 63.5 to 67.5 – 61% tickets and 98% of the money.  It’s me vs the sharps on this one.

Miss State vs Alabama over 62.5 to 64 – 53% tickets and 88% of the money.

Ohio State vs Penn State over 61 to 64.5 – 62% tickets and 88% of the money.

Oklahoma vs Texas Tech over 66.5 to 69 – 40% tickets and 75% of the money.

San Diego State vs Utah State under 49.5 to 43.5 – 65% tickets and 93% of the money.
